excel排序为什么总是10前面
作者:百问excel教程网
|
171人看过
发布时间:2026-01-22 11:53:06
标签:
Excel 排序为何总是“10”前面?深度解析与实用建议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和管理中。在日常使用中,用户常常会遇到一个常见问题:在排序操作后,数据总是按照“10”前面排列。这个问题看似简单
Excel 排序为何总是“10”前面?深度解析与实用建议
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和管理中。在日常使用中,用户常常会遇到一个常见问题:在排序操作后,数据总是按照“10”前面排列。这个问题看似简单,但背后涉及Excel的排序机制、数据结构、函数使用等多个层面,需要深入理解才能有效解决。
一、Excel 排序的基本原理
Excel 的排序功能,本质上是通过“排序字段”对数据进行重新排列。排序字段可以是数值、文本、日期、时间等不同类型的属性。Excel 会根据这些字段对数据进行升序或降序排列。
在默认情况下,Excel 会优先按第一个排序字段进行排序,如果该字段没有指定,则会按第二个字段进行排序,依此类推。
二、排序默认行为的解释
Excel 排序默认行为主要受以下因素影响:
1. 排序字段的类型
Excel 对不同类型的字段排序逻辑不同。例如,数值型字段(如“10”、“20”)默认按数值大小排序,而文本型字段(如“10”、“20”)则按字母顺序排序。如果用户没有指定排序字段,Excel 会根据第一个字段进行排序。
2. 数据的原始顺序
如果数据本身没有顺序,Excel 会根据字段的值进行排序,而不是根据其在数据中的位置。
3. 排序方向(升序或降序)
默认情况下,Excel 采用升序排序,但用户也可以通过“排序”功能设置降序。
三、为何“10”总是排在前面?
在某些情况下,用户可能会发现数据中“10”总是排在前面,这通常是由于以下原因:
1. 数据中存在“10”作为文本字段
如果数据中包含“10”作为文本,例如“10”、“20”、“30”等,Excel 会将其视为文本字段进行排序,而不是数值字段。这种情况下,Excel 会按文本顺序排序,即按字母顺序排列,因此“10”会排在“20”前面。
2. 未指定排序字段,按第一个字段排序
如果用户没有指定排序字段,Excel 会根据第一个字段进行排序。若该字段中存在“10”这样的值,Excel 会优先显示这些值,因此“10”会排在前面。
3. 数据中存在多个“10”
如果数据中存在多个“10”,Excel 会按文本顺序进行排列,因此“10”会排在前面。
四、如何解决“10”总是排在前面的问题?
1. 明确排序字段
在进行排序之前,明确指定排序字段。可以通过以下步骤实现:
- 选择数据区域。
- 点击“数据”选项卡。
- 选择“排序”。
- 在“排序”对话框中,选择排序字段(如“数值”或“文本”)。
- 设置排序方向(升序或降序)。
- 确认排序后,数据将按指定字段排序。
2. 将“10”转换为数值类型
如果“10”是文本类型,可以将其转换为数值类型,以确保排序按数值顺序进行。操作方法如下:
- 选中“10”单元格。
- 点击“数据”选项卡。
- 选择“文本转列”。
- 在“分列”对话框中,选择“数值”作为数据类型。
- 确认转换后,数据将按数值排序。
3. 使用公式进行排序
如果数据中存在多个“10”,可以通过公式进行更精确的排序。例如:
- 使用 `=ROW()` 函数对数据进行编号。
- 使用 `=IF(ROW()=1, "10", "")` 生成一个标识列。
- 使用 `=IF(ROW()=2, "20", "")` 生成另一个标识列。
- 通过排序功能,按标识列进行排序。
五、Excel 排序的高级技巧
1. 使用“自定义排序”功能
Excel 提供了“自定义排序”功能,允许用户对多个字段进行排序。例如,可以按“数值”排序,同时按“文本”排序,以实现更精细的控制。
2. 使用“排序和筛选”组合
在排序后,使用“筛选”功能可以快速定位特定值。例如,可以筛选出所有“10”值,以便进行进一步处理。
3. 使用“排序”功能中的“自定义排序”选项
在“排序”对话框中,可以添加多个排序条件,例如按“数值”排序,同时按“文本”排序,以实现更复杂的排序逻辑。
六、常见误区与错误操作
1. 误将文本字段当作数值字段排序
如果用户将“10”作为文本字段进行排序,Excel 会按字母顺序排序,导致“10”排在前面。为了避免这种情况,应确保字段类型正确。
2. 未指定排序字段,导致数据混乱
如果用户未指定排序字段,Excel 会根据第一个字段进行排序,可能导致数据混乱。因此,在进行排序前,应明确指定字段。
3. 使用错误的排序方向
Excel 默认使用升序排序,但用户也可以设置降序。如果用户误用了错误的方向,可能导致数据排列不符合预期。
七、总结
Excel 排序“10”总是排在前面,通常是由于字段类型、排序字段未指定或数据本身存在文本值等原因导致的。解决这一问题的关键在于明确排序字段、正确设置排序方向,并确保数据类型正确。通过上述方法,用户可以更有效地管理数据,提高工作效率。
在实际应用中,用户应根据具体需求灵活调整排序方式,以实现最佳的数据排列效果。无论是日常办公还是数据分析,掌握Excel的排序技巧,都是提升工作效率的重要一环。
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、分析和管理中。在日常使用中,用户常常会遇到一个常见问题:在排序操作后,数据总是按照“10”前面排列。这个问题看似简单,但背后涉及Excel的排序机制、数据结构、函数使用等多个层面,需要深入理解才能有效解决。
一、Excel 排序的基本原理
Excel 的排序功能,本质上是通过“排序字段”对数据进行重新排列。排序字段可以是数值、文本、日期、时间等不同类型的属性。Excel 会根据这些字段对数据进行升序或降序排列。
在默认情况下,Excel 会优先按第一个排序字段进行排序,如果该字段没有指定,则会按第二个字段进行排序,依此类推。
二、排序默认行为的解释
Excel 排序默认行为主要受以下因素影响:
1. 排序字段的类型
Excel 对不同类型的字段排序逻辑不同。例如,数值型字段(如“10”、“20”)默认按数值大小排序,而文本型字段(如“10”、“20”)则按字母顺序排序。如果用户没有指定排序字段,Excel 会根据第一个字段进行排序。
2. 数据的原始顺序
如果数据本身没有顺序,Excel 会根据字段的值进行排序,而不是根据其在数据中的位置。
3. 排序方向(升序或降序)
默认情况下,Excel 采用升序排序,但用户也可以通过“排序”功能设置降序。
三、为何“10”总是排在前面?
在某些情况下,用户可能会发现数据中“10”总是排在前面,这通常是由于以下原因:
1. 数据中存在“10”作为文本字段
如果数据中包含“10”作为文本,例如“10”、“20”、“30”等,Excel 会将其视为文本字段进行排序,而不是数值字段。这种情况下,Excel 会按文本顺序排序,即按字母顺序排列,因此“10”会排在“20”前面。
2. 未指定排序字段,按第一个字段排序
如果用户没有指定排序字段,Excel 会根据第一个字段进行排序。若该字段中存在“10”这样的值,Excel 会优先显示这些值,因此“10”会排在前面。
3. 数据中存在多个“10”
如果数据中存在多个“10”,Excel 会按文本顺序进行排列,因此“10”会排在前面。
四、如何解决“10”总是排在前面的问题?
1. 明确排序字段
在进行排序之前,明确指定排序字段。可以通过以下步骤实现:
- 选择数据区域。
- 点击“数据”选项卡。
- 选择“排序”。
- 在“排序”对话框中,选择排序字段(如“数值”或“文本”)。
- 设置排序方向(升序或降序)。
- 确认排序后,数据将按指定字段排序。
2. 将“10”转换为数值类型
如果“10”是文本类型,可以将其转换为数值类型,以确保排序按数值顺序进行。操作方法如下:
- 选中“10”单元格。
- 点击“数据”选项卡。
- 选择“文本转列”。
- 在“分列”对话框中,选择“数值”作为数据类型。
- 确认转换后,数据将按数值排序。
3. 使用公式进行排序
如果数据中存在多个“10”,可以通过公式进行更精确的排序。例如:
- 使用 `=ROW()` 函数对数据进行编号。
- 使用 `=IF(ROW()=1, "10", "")` 生成一个标识列。
- 使用 `=IF(ROW()=2, "20", "")` 生成另一个标识列。
- 通过排序功能,按标识列进行排序。
五、Excel 排序的高级技巧
1. 使用“自定义排序”功能
Excel 提供了“自定义排序”功能,允许用户对多个字段进行排序。例如,可以按“数值”排序,同时按“文本”排序,以实现更精细的控制。
2. 使用“排序和筛选”组合
在排序后,使用“筛选”功能可以快速定位特定值。例如,可以筛选出所有“10”值,以便进行进一步处理。
3. 使用“排序”功能中的“自定义排序”选项
在“排序”对话框中,可以添加多个排序条件,例如按“数值”排序,同时按“文本”排序,以实现更复杂的排序逻辑。
六、常见误区与错误操作
1. 误将文本字段当作数值字段排序
如果用户将“10”作为文本字段进行排序,Excel 会按字母顺序排序,导致“10”排在前面。为了避免这种情况,应确保字段类型正确。
2. 未指定排序字段,导致数据混乱
如果用户未指定排序字段,Excel 会根据第一个字段进行排序,可能导致数据混乱。因此,在进行排序前,应明确指定字段。
3. 使用错误的排序方向
Excel 默认使用升序排序,但用户也可以设置降序。如果用户误用了错误的方向,可能导致数据排列不符合预期。
七、总结
Excel 排序“10”总是排在前面,通常是由于字段类型、排序字段未指定或数据本身存在文本值等原因导致的。解决这一问题的关键在于明确排序字段、正确设置排序方向,并确保数据类型正确。通过上述方法,用户可以更有效地管理数据,提高工作效率。
在实际应用中,用户应根据具体需求灵活调整排序方式,以实现最佳的数据排列效果。无论是日常办公还是数据分析,掌握Excel的排序技巧,都是提升工作效率的重要一环。
推荐文章
Excel 下拉菜单又有什么作用?深度解析与实用技巧Excel 是一款广受欢迎的办公软件,其功能强大,操作便捷,尤其在数据处理和分析方面表现突出。其中,下拉菜单(DropDown List) 是 Excel 中一个非常实用的工
2026-01-22 11:52:55
107人看过
Excel刷新是什么快捷键?Excel 是一款广泛使用的电子表格软件,它在商业、财务、数据分析等领域中占据着重要地位。Excel 提供了多种功能,包括数据输入、公式计算、图表制作、数据筛选等。其中,Excel 刷新功能是数据更新的重要
2026-01-22 11:52:44
150人看过
Excel 为什么筛选不出来?深入解析常见问题与解决方案在日常办公中,Excel 是一个不可或缺的工具。它以其强大的数据处理与分析能力,帮助用户高效地处理大量信息。然而,有时候在使用 Excel 时,用户会遇到一个令人困扰的问题:“为
2026-01-22 11:52:39
160人看过
Excel 的 23 什么意思啊?在 Excel 中,数字“23”通常指的是一个简单的数值,但在某些特定的上下文中,这个数字可能具有更深层次的含义。尤其是在一些特定的Excel功能或公式中,数字“23”可能代表某种计算方式或操作步骤。
2026-01-22 11:52:34
98人看过
.webp)


.webp)